如何换一个用户登录服务器

fiy 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在服务器操作中,常常需要切换用户登录来执行不同的操作或访问不同的权限。下面将介绍如何在服务器上切换用户登录的具体步骤。

    1. 以管理员身份登录服务器。
      登录服务器时,需要使用具有管理员权限的用户账号和密码进行登录。一般情况下,管理员账号是在服务器安装时创建的。

    2. 使用su命令切换用户。
      su命令是用于在Linux操作系统中切换用户的命令。在终端中输入以下命令:

    su - 用户名
    

    其中,用户名是要切换到的用户账号。例如,要切换到名为"testuser"的用户账号,输入以下命令:

    su - testuser
    

    密码为切换后的用户账号密码,输入正确后即可切换到该用户。

    1. 使用sudo命令切换用户。
      sudo命令是用于在Unix和Unix-like系统中以其他用户身份执行命令的命令。在终端中输入以下命令:
    sudo -i -u 用户名
    

    其中,用户名是要切换到的用户账号。例如,要切换到名为"testuser"的用户账号,输入以下命令:

    sudo -i -u testuser
    

    执行命令后,会要求输入当前用户的密码,输入正确后即可切换到该用户。

    1. 使用ssh命令切换用户。
      如果需要通过远程连接方式切换用户登录服务器,可以使用ssh命令。在本地和远程服务器的终端中输入以下命令:
    ssh 用户名@服务器IP地址
    

    其中,用户名是要切换到的用户账号,服务器IP地址是服务器的IP地址。例如,要切换到名为"testuser"的用户账号,连接IP地址为192.168.1.1的服务器,输入以下命令:

    ssh testuser@192.168.1.1
    

    成功连接后,会要求输入当前用户的密码,输入正确后即可切换到该用户。

    总结:
    通过以上几种方式,我们可以很方便地在服务器上切换用户登录。无论是在本地还是通过远程连接方式,都可以根据实际需求选择适合的方法来进行切换。请注意在切换用户时输入正确的账号和密码,确保安全性和权限的正确使用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要换一个用户登录服务器,需要按照以下步骤进行:

    1. 注销当前用户:在服务器控制台上输入命令logout或者exit,以注销当前用户并返回登录界面。

    2. 输入新用户信息:在登录界面输入新用户的用户名和密码。如果是首次登录服务器,通常需要管理员提供预设的新用户账号和密码。

    3. 输入正确的用户名:确保你输入的用户名是正确的,大小写也需要匹配。如果输入的用户名不正确,系统会提示“用户不存在”的错误信息。

    4. 输入正确的密码:输入与新用户匹配的密码。密码是区分大小写的,所以请确保按照正确的大小写输入。

    5. 登录服务器:当输入正确的用户名和密码后,按下回车键登录服务器。如果一切正常,你将成功登录服务器并能够开始进行操作。

    需要注意的是,在某些情况下,服务器可能会限制用户登录的权限,或者需要输入其他安全验证信息。如果遇到这种情况,应该联系服务器管理员获取进一步的帮助和指导。

    总结:要换一个用户登录服务器,首先注销当前用户,在登录界面输入新用户的用户名和密码,确保输入正确,并按下回车键登录服务器。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在一个服务器上,可以有多个用户账号,不同的用户账号有不同的权限和资源访问权限。当你想要切换到另一个用户账号时,可以通过以下方法进行操作:

    1.查看当前用户账号
    首先,你可以通过 whoami 命令查看当前登录的用户名。该命令会显示当前用户账号的用户名。

    2.注销当前用户
    如果你希望注销当前的用户账号,可以使用 logout 命令。该命令会结束当前用户的登录会话并返回到登录界面。在使用 logout 命令后,你需要输入新的用户名和密码进行登录。

    3.切换用户
    如果你不想注销当前用户账号,而是想切换到另一个用户账号,可以使用 su 命令。su 命令允许你切换到其他用户账号,并且可以选择使用该用户的环境变量、工作目录等。

    默认情况下,执行 su 命令只会切换到 root 用户账号。如果你想要切换到其他非 root 用户账号,需要在 su 命令后面加上用户名。例如,要切换到名为 user2 的用户账号,可以使用以下命令:

    su user2
    

    当你执行该命令后,会要求你输入 user2 的密码。输入正确的密码后,你会切换到 user2 用户账号。

    4.以其他用户身份执行命令
    如果你只是希望临时以其他用户身份执行某个命令,而不是切换到该用户账号,可以使用 sudo 命令。sudo 命令允许普通用户以 root 用户的权限执行某个命令。

    例如,要以 root 权限执行 ls 命令,可以使用以下命令:

    sudo ls
    

    执行该命令后,会要求你输入当前用户的密码(不是 root 密码),输入正确的密码后,ls 命令会以 root 用户的权限执行。

    以上就是在服务器上切换用户登录的方法和操作流程,通过注销当前用户或切换到其他用户,你可以在同一台服务器上使用不同的用户账号进行操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部